Admission Quota & Categories
The KVS lottery system randomly selects candidates within specific priority groups. Understanding these categories helps in interpreting the results:
- RTE Quota: 25% of seats are reserved for Right to Education.
- Service Priority Category: Children of central/state government employees.
- Single Girl Child (SGC) Quota: Reserved seats for parents with only one female child.
- EWS/BPL Category: Reserved for students from economically weaker sections.
How to Check KVS Lottery Result 2026 Online
Checking the result is straightforward. Follow these steps to access your child’s selection status:
- Visit the official KVS admission portal at admission.kvs.gov.in or the main website kvsangathan.nic.in.
- On the homepage, look for the link titled “Check Application Status” or “Class 1 Lottery Result 2026”.
- Enter your Login Code, child’s Date of Birth, and Mobile Number used during registration.
- Solve the security captcha and click on Login.
- Your child’s application dashboard will open, displaying the lottery results for each school you applied to.
- Alternatively, visit the individual KV’s official website and navigate to the “Announcements” section to download the selection list PDF.
Documents Required for Admission
If your child’s name appears in the “Selected” list, you must visit the respective school with the following documents for verification:
- Birth Certificate: Original and a self-attested photocopy.
- Photographs: Two recent passport-sized photos of the child.
- Residence Proof: Electricity bill, Aadhaar card, or rent agreement.
- Category Certificate: SC/ST/OBC/EWS/BPL certificates (if applicable).
- Service Certificate: For parents under the government service priority category.
- Distance Declaration: For RTE candidates (proof of residence within 5-8 km).

1. What does “Waiting List” (WL) mean in the KVS result?
If your child is on the waiting list, it means they have not been selected in the first round. However, if any selected candidate fails to complete the admission or surrenders their seat, the vacancy is filled by candidates in the WL based on their rank.
2. Can I check the result offline?
Yes, every Kendriya Vidyalaya displays the provisional selection list on their physical notice board. You can visit the specific school you applied to and check the lists manually.
3. My child is selected in two schools. Can I take admission in both?
No, you can only choose one school for final admission. Once you complete the verification and pay the fees at one school, the child’s registration will be locked for that specific KV.
4. What is the “Post-Lottery Number”in KVS Lottery Result 2026?
The post-lottery number is the final rank assigned to your child after the computerized randomization. A lower number indicates a higher priority for selection.
